apache + nginx reverse proxy 에 관하여 궁금한게 있습니다.
설명절 다들 잘 보내셨는지요.
전 연휴 내내 덜먹고 덜놀고 공부좀 해보자 하면서 알지도 못하는 서버만 만지작하고 있었습니다.
apache + nginx reverse proxy 조합이 좋다고들 해서
(거기에 varnish까지 얹히면 더 좋다고들 하기도 하구요)
설치를 한번 해보았는데요..
설치가 끝나고 짧은주소 적용과 https강제 이동을 위해 htaccess 파일을 만지다보니 nginx에서는 rewrite.conf로 설정한다는 것을 읽은 것이 기억나더군요.
그럼 난 여지껏 htaccess 파일을 가지고 뭘 한거지?
엥? 그런데 htaccess파일을 변경해보니 RewriteEngine On이며 rewriterule 이며 다 되던데?
이렇더라구요..
https://blog.naver.com/yves1/140111512409
위 글을 대충 읽어보니 nginx reverse proxy로 사용하면 apache의 native 기능을 그대로 사용할 수 있다는 것 같은데 제가 맞게 이해한건가요?
htaccess파일 익히는 것도 어려운데 nginx.conf나 rewrite.conf에 대해 익히지 않아도 된다는 생각에 기분은 좋아졌는데 제가 맞게 하고 있는지 의심이 됩니다.
이렇게 해도 되는건가요?
|
댓글을 작성하시려면 로그인이 필요합니다.
로그인
댓글 3개
htaccess 가 잘 먹으면 셋팅을 잘 하신겁니다. 축하드립니다....^^
그런데 아파치와 nginx 의 포트를 80번으로 사용 하시나요?
아님 하나는 80 다른 하나는 8080 으로 쓰시는지요?
htaccess가 작동하는게 정상적인건데 제가 너무 겁을 먹었군요.
현재 apache는 8080으로 nginx는 80으로 사용합니다. 이렇게 해야 nginx proxy 설정이 apache단으로 넘어간다고 하는 것 같더라구요..